首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

wordpress 云服务器配置

WordPress 是一个流行的开源内容管理系统(CMS),广泛用于构建网站和博客。为了在云服务器上成功部署 WordPress,需要考虑以下几个基础概念和配置要点:

基础概念

  1. 云服务器:云服务器是一种基于云计算技术的虚拟化服务器,提供了弹性、可扩展的计算资源。
  2. Web 服务器:如 Apache 或 Nginx,用于处理 HTTP 请求。
  3. 数据库服务器:如 MySQL 或 MariaDB,用于存储 WordPress 的数据。
  4. PHP:WordPress 是用 PHP 编写的,因此需要在服务器上安装 PHP 运行环境。
  5. 文件系统:用于存储 WordPress 的文件和目录。

配置优势

  • 可扩展性:云服务器可以根据需求动态调整资源。
  • 高可用性:通过负载均衡和自动备份提高系统的可靠性。
  • 成本效益:按需付费模式,避免了传统服务器的高昂初期投资。

类型与应用场景

  • 通用型云服务器:适用于大多数 WordPress 网站。
  • 内存优化型:适合流量较大、需要快速响应的网站。
  • GPU 加速型:适用于需要图形处理能力的应用,如视频编辑或游戏服务器。

配置步骤

  1. 选择合适的云服务器实例
    • 根据预期的流量和资源需求选择 CPU、内存、存储等配置。
  • 安装 Web 服务器
    • 对于 Apache:
    • 对于 Apache:
    • 对于 Nginx:
    • 对于 Nginx:
  • 安装数据库服务器
  • 安装数据库服务器
  • 安装 PHP 及相关扩展
  • 安装 PHP 及相关扩展
  • 配置数据库
    • 登录 MySQL 并创建一个新的数据库和用户:
    • 登录 MySQL 并创建一个新的数据库和用户:
  • 下载并安装 WordPress
    • 下载最新版本的 WordPress:
    • 下载最新版本的 WordPress:
    • 设置文件权限:
    • 设置文件权限:
  • 配置 WordPress
    • 复制 WordPress 配置文件:
    • 复制 WordPress 配置文件:
    • 编辑 wp-config.php 文件,设置数据库信息:
    • 编辑 wp-config.php 文件,设置数据库信息:
  • 设置防火墙规则
    • 允许 HTTP 和 HTTPS 流量:
    • 允许 HTTP 和 HTTPS 流量:

常见问题及解决方法

  1. 无法访问网站
    • 检查 Web 服务器是否正常运行:
    • 检查 Web 服务器是否正常运行:
    • 确保防火墙允许 HTTP/HTTPS 流量。
  • 数据库连接错误
    • 确认数据库名称、用户名和密码是否正确。
    • 检查数据库服务器是否正常运行:
    • 检查数据库服务器是否正常运行:
  • 性能问题
    • 使用缓存插件如 W3 Total Cache 提高网站速度。
    • 考虑升级云服务器配置或使用 CDN 加速内容分发。

通过以上步骤和解决方案,可以有效地在云服务器上部署和管理 WordPress 网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券